• David Cassidy, 66, the '70s teen heartthrob and star of "The Partridge Family," has gone public with news that he is battling dementia. [People]

• Filmmaker Guillermo Del Toro says plans for a third "Hellboy" movie are officially and finally dead. [The Hollywood Reporter]

• "The LEGO Batman Movie" topped a tepid Presidents Day weekend at the box office, while newcomers "The Great Wall," "Fist Fight" and "A Cure for Wellness" underperformed. [Box Office Mojo]
